The Watford branch of Berry Recruitment and the local Rotary club have joined forces to deliver a bumper donation to the town’s food bank – just in time for Christmas.
Berry Recruitment Group – a national company – made donations to a number of food banks around the country.
In Watford, the staff at the recruitment company have strong links with the Rotary club, and together they teamed up to help provide food for those in need.
Elected Mayor of Watford Peter Taylor and town councillor Rabi Martins were there when the parcels were donated.
Carol Grainger, who manages the branch, said: “It was very generous of our company directors to make a donation. In Watford, we try and do our bit for charities within our community and this was a great opportunity to help others.
“While Christmas is a time when people do give generously, there are people who need help with their meals all year round. We were able to supply many types of food and being from Berry Recruitment we made sure there were some berries included.
“It was very humbling to see what basics the food bank had, and to play a small part in this worthy and necessary charity.”
The food bank gives out 10 tonnes of food per month, but donations can drop by half in January.
